When booking domestic flights with Indian airlines, understanding DL slot cancellation charges is crucial for travelers. These charges refer to the fees applied when canceling a reserved flight slot with various domestic carriers operating in India.
Most Indian domestic airlines have specific cancellation policies that vary based on factors such as the time of cancellation, fare type, and route. Typically, cancellation charges range from a small fee to a significant percentage of the ticket price, depending on how close to departure the cancellation is made.
Many airlines in India offer different fare categories, including flexible fares that allow cancellations with minimal charges and basic economy fares that may have higher cancellation fees. It\“s important for passengers to carefully read the terms and conditions before booking.
Some Indian domestic carriers provide a 24-hour free cancellation window from the time of booking, allowing travelers to cancel without any charges. However, this policy may vary between airlines and specific fare types.
Passengers should also be aware that cancellation charges are typically deducted from the refund amount, and the remaining balance is credited back to the original payment method or as airline credit, depending on the carrier\“s policy. |
